Pentafluorobenzoic acid

Replacement of hydroxyl by fluorine converts perfluoroalkanecarboxylic acids toperfluoroalkanoylfluorides The short chain acids react exothermally with FAR added in a dropwise manner, whereas the longer chain acids require heating [78] (equation 49) Attempts to fluorinate pentafluorobenzoic acid with FAR leads to decarboxylation to give pentafluorobenzene [78]... [Pg.219]

Alkaline hydrolysis of pentafluorobenzoic acid, the probable intermediate in the alkaline hydrolysis of perfluorotoluene, gives a high yield of p-hydroxytetra fluorobenzoic acid [9, 10 (equation 10)... [Pg.425]

Polyfluorobenzyl alcohols are one class of fluorinated starting materials for medicinal and agricultural usage. Practical electrochemical methods for the product-selective synthesis of polyfluorobenzyl alcohols have been developed [79, 80], 2,3,4,5,6-Pentafluorobenzoic acid is reduced selectively to 2,3,4,5,6-pentafluorobenzyl alcohol at amalgamated lead, zinc and cadmium cathodes in aqueous sulfuric acid solutions, while 2,3,5,6-tetrafluorobenzyl alcohol can also be obtained selectively by using the non-amalgamated cathodes in solutions containing small amounts of a quartemary ammonium salt [79],... [Pg.45]

Fig. 4 High-resolution solid-state NMR spectrum of the 1 1 cocrystal containing benzoic acid (BA) and pentafluorobenzoic acid (PFBA). The two peaks at ca. 174 ppm represent the carboxylic acid group of PFBA and the two peaks at ca. 167 ppm represent the carboxylic acid group of BA... Pentafluorobenzoic acid [602-94-8] M 212.1, m 101-103 , 103-104 , 104-105 , 106-107 . Dissolve in Et20, treat with charcoal, filter, dry (CaSO4), filter, evaporate and recrystallise residue from pet ether (b 90-100°) after adding a little toluene to give large colourless plates. UV (H2O) Xmax 265nm (e 761). The S-benzylisothiuronium salt has m 187° after recrystn from H2O. [McBee and Rapkin JACS 73 1366 1951-. Nield et al. JCS 166, 170 7959]. [Pg.295]

Alkaline hydrolysis of pentafluorobenzoic acid gives a high yield of perfluoro-4-hydroxybenzoic acid (4),35 -37... [Pg.386]

Pentafluorobenzoic acid with sodium methoxide yields tetrafluoro-4-methoxybenzoic acid (24).98... [Pg.399]

This mode of interaction has been empirically observed in the crystal structures of the cocrystals formed by benzamide and pentafluorobenzoic acid [15,16]. [Pg.374]

Pentafluorobenzoic acid reduced selectively to either 2,3,5,6-tetrafluorobenzyl alcohol (87) or 2,3,5,6-tetrafluorobenzaldehyde (88) at a lead cathode in dilute sulfuric acid in the presence of quaternary ammonium salts75(equation 51). This is an interesting reaction that could involve loss of fluoride ion from an intermediate radical anion followed by further reduction (Scheme 5). [Pg.1024]

Acylation of pentafluorobenzene to form ketones either with acid halides or with anhydrides has been achieved with excess SbFg [22]. Use of phosgene in place of acid chlorides results in the formation of pentafluorobenzoic acid in good yield [4]. [Pg.526]
